| Addiction Services for York Region |
We are a non-profit agency that supports change in the lives of individuals, their families and communities related to substance use and gambling. We serve anyone 12 years of age and older who is affected by substance use or problem gambling. We understand that substance abuse and problem gambling are the result of personal lifestyle issues and coping strategies. We also recognize the detrimental effects of addictions on the emotional, mental and physical health of individuals, their families and friends. |
| AIDS Committee of York Region |
The AIDS Committee of York Region is a community-based, non-profit organization, which embraces the GIPA* principles, provides support, and offers education which promotes the development of a caring and compassionate society, as well as access to dignified care for people affected and infected by HIV/AIDS. *GIPA=Greater Involvement of People with HIV/AIDS (UNAIDS). |

| Blue Hills Child and Family Centre |
Client centred services focus on social, emotional and behavioural well-being primarily for children, youth and their families and includes residential programs, nonresidential programs and programs geared to the support and education of staff of other child serving systems. Specific services include: Individual, Family, Marital, Group, Play Therapy, Intensive Services, specialized birth to 6 Services, Triple P, Treatment Foster Care and Children's Therapeutic Residential Services. |
| Citizens for Affordable Housing |
Maintains a housing registry to assist individuals in securing affordable accommodation that exists in the private rental market. The centre is operated by the Affordable Housing Committee of York.

| CMHA York Region |
The Canadian Mental Health Association, York Region Branch was founded in 1984 and is dedicated to improving the quality of life for people with mental illnesses. We help people learn how to maintain their mental health, look for and identify the signs of mental illness, and get help and support when they need it. Through several locations across York Region and South Simcoe, we provide a wide range of services to assist individuals with their recovery. Our multi-disciplinary team of professionals are dedicated to assisting people achieve their optimum level of mental health. |
| Community Legal Clinic of York Region |
Provides legal service (advice/representation); public legal education assistance to community groups with law reform and community development; community legal clinic funded by Legal Aid Ontario; provides summary advice by telephone; produces and distributes free public legal education materials; speakers are available to community agencies at no cost; specialists in the laws concerning landlord and tenants act. Will refer to appropriate clinic. Does not give legal advice on any real estate matters. Also gives advice on who to contact for welfare, WSIB; disability legal issues. |
| Georgina Mobility Transit (Operating Transit Georgina) |
We are a small, grassroots, non-profit organization committed to providing affordable transportation. Our screened, reliable, volunteer drivers use their own vehicles to connect members of our community with the services and supports they require. We provide transportation to those who are unable to access the supports or services they need. These clients are often restricted due to their financial situation or other life circumstances. We require a minimum of 24 hours notice. We cannot provide emergency service. Annually, we provide over 12,000 rides. |
| Jewish Family and Child Services |
Jewish Family & Child supports the healthy development of individuals, children, families and communities through prevention, protection, counselling, education and advocacy services, within the context of Jewish values. |
| Learning Disabilities Association of York Region |
The Learning Disabilities Association provides information, support, guidance and resources to people with Learning Disabilities (LD) and Attention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D). We try to help people increase their opportunities and realize their potential. |
